15Ni-15Co-3.1Mo is a maraging steel—a high-strength, low-carbon iron alloy strengthened by precipitation hardening rather than carbon content, making it exceptionally tough and weldable compared to conventional high-strength steels. This grade is used in aerospace structures, tooling, and demanding mechanical components where a combination of high strength, fracture toughness, and dimensional stability after heat treatment is critical. Engineers select maraging steels when conventional hardened alloy steels would be too brittle, when welding without embrittlement is essential, or when tight dimensional tolerances must be maintained through the hardening cycle.
